NCT04304404: BrCaRRP
Risk Reduction Program for Women Having High Risk of Breast Cancer
NA trial testing Breast Cancer Risk Reduction Program (BrCaRRP) in Cancer Screening in 77 participants. Completed in 1 September 2021.

Who can join
Adults 25 to 70, female only, with Cancer Screening or Early Detection of Cancer. Patients with the condition only — healthy volunteers not accepted.
Sponsor's own description
An intervention program involving education, guidance, counseling, case management and surveillance based on the Health Belief Model will be implemented on women with high risk of breast cancer. The impact of the breast cancer risk reduction program on participation in breast cancer screenings, health beliefs (health motivation, sensitivity, fear of breast cancer) and behaviors (physical activity, nutrition, health responsibility, genetic counseling) will be evaluated in the study.
